Hoosier Quick Times
Im just curious if anybody has ever run these Hoosiers? Not too conserned about performance (i know they will do fine). Im more worried about sizing. I plan on running a 16x6 wheel and it says that the minimum is 6". Also, is the height on this going to fit okay? ATM im on Sportlines but within a few weeks i will have KSport coilovers so i will have some adjustability. Please and thanks

you can run a 26" just fine. but with the 3.85 final of the tc, plus a taller tire will kill you're torque. i forgot how much power youre making on your swap but i would say its either/or if you want to run a 24.5 or a 26.
heres my 245/50/16 nt555r's. they're 25.6" tall.. i'm also on ksport coils
